What is a Gazette Name Change?

A Gazette Name Change is the official procedure for changing your legal name. This involves submitting a notarized affidavit, publishing the change in newspapers, and obtaining notification in the Gazette of India. Once processed, your new name is valid for all personal, professional, and legal purposes, ensuring that all records, including your Aadhaar, PAN card, and bank accounts, reflect your updated identity. Eligibility for a Gazette Name Change

To apply for a Gazette Name Change, individuals must meet certain eligibility criteria. Applicants must be adults aged 18 or above. Guardians can apply on behalf of minors under 18 years. This process is available for Indian citizens, including NRIs. Ensure that the name change is not intended for fraudulent purposes or to evade legal obligations.   • Adults aged 18 years and above are eligible to apply.
  • Guardians can apply for minors under 18 years.
  • Open to Indian citizens, including Non-Resident Indians (NRIs).
  • The change must not be used for fraudulent activities.
  • No attempt should be made to evade legal obligations through this change.

Criteria for Legal Name Change

Legal criteria ensure that the name change is valid and acceptable to authorities. Ensure that the new name is not offensive, vulgar, or politically sensitive. It should not conflict with another individual’s identity, and a valid reason must be provided if necessary. It's crucial to submit accurate documentation to prevent delays in processing.   • The new name must not be offensive, vulgar, or politically sensitive.
  • It must not conflict with another person’s identity.
  • A valid reason, if required, should be provided.
  • All necessary documents must be submitted accurately.
  • Ensure submission of correct information to prevent processing delays.

Documents Required for Name Change

Certain documents are mandatory to support the legal process of a name change. These are crucial in verifying the identity, residence, and authenticity of the applicant. It's essential to prepare a notarized affidavit, publish the change in newspapers, and apply for a Gazette notification.   • Notarized Affidavit declaring your old and new names.
  • Proof of Identity: Aadhaar, PAN Card, Passport, or Voter ID.
  • Proof of Address: Utility bills, Aadhaar, or Passport.
  • Publication in local and national newspapers.
  • Gazette Notification Application to formalize the name change.

Procedure for Legally Changing Your Name

The procedure involves several steps to legally recognize your new name. This ensures that all records, both government and private, are updated accordingly. Begin by preparing an affidavit declaring your old and new names, publishing the change in newspapers, and applying for a Gazette notification. Once the Gazette notification is issued, update all official documents, including Aadhaar, PAN, passport, and educational certificates.   • Draft and notarize an affidavit declaring new and old names.
  • Publish name change in one local and one national newspaper.
  • Apply to include your new name in the official Gazette of India.
  • After Gazette notification, update all official records and documents.
  • Ensure all records reflect the changes to avoid discrepancies.
